Brian Maienschein

Brian Maienschein (born May 22, 1969 in Independence , Missouri ) is an American politician. He belongs to the Republican Party .

At the age of seven, Brian Maienschein's family moved to Poway , Southern California . Brian attended local high school and graduated from the University of California, Santa Barbara in 1991 . He then studied at the California Western School of Law and completed his training with a Juris Doctor . Maienschein now teaches election law at this college and the University of San Diego School of Law .

Brian Maienschein's political career began when he was elected to the San Diego City Council in 2000. He was re-elected in 2004 and served the maximum two terms allowed. After retiring from the city council, he worked on the San Diego County's program to combat chronic homelessness .

In 2012 Maienschein ran for the California State Assembly in the 77th electoral district and won the election with 60.1%. In 2014 he was re-elected with 65.8%.
